Not every isekai involves dying to get there.
That's a far more modern (like 2010 or so onwards) thing. And even then, not always, like Rising of the Shield Hero.

A lot of the earlier isekai stories just involved going through a portal or something, and since the main character never died, getting back home is still hoped for or expected.
Examples: Urashima Taro, A Connecticut Yankee in King Arthur's Court, Alice in Wonderland, Peter Pan, Fushigi Yuugi, El Hazard: The Magnificent World, Spirited Away, etc...
